Koreatown Rent Report — December 2024

Asking rents in ZIP 90006, Los Angeles, from 133 listings.

Median 1BR rent in Koreatown was $2,000 in December 2024, down 1.9% (−$38) from November 2024 and up 53.8% year-over-year. The middle half of 1BR listings asked between $1,895 and $2,365. That puts Koreatown $68 below the Los Angeles citywide 1BR median of $2,068. The month's figures are based on 133 listings across 12 bedroom categories.
